It consists of a large number of equally spaced parallel slits. Distance between two consecutive slits (lines) of the grating is called a grating element. Grating element 'd' is calculated as: Grating element =Length of grating/Number of In optics, a diffraction grating is an optical component with a regular pattern, which splits (diffracts) light into several beams travelling in different directions. The directions of these beams depend on the spacing of the grating and the wavelength of the light so that the grating acts as a dispersive element. A diffraction grating is a plate on which there is a very large number of parallel, identical, close-spaced slits. As a leader in the design and manufacture of diffraction gratings, Newport offers precision components for analytical instruments, laser and telecommunications equipment manufacturers How gratings work A diffraction grating consists of a series of parallel slits, notches, lines, or steps (some kind of quasi-1D structure). When a plane wave is incident on this structure, each divot will act like a point source, emitting a spherical wavefront (or more accurately, a cylindrical one).
